When embarking on the journey to find a reliable plumbing contractor, start by conducting thorough research. Look for contractors with a solid reputation in the industry. Reading online reviews and asking for recommendations from friends or family can be a great start. Check if the contractor is licensed and insured, as this not only protects you but also indicates a level of professionalism and adherence to industry standards.
Once you have a shortlist of potential candidates, it’s time to dig deeper. Start by setting up interviews to ask some key questions. Firstly, inquire about the contractor's experience and how long they have been in business. A seasoned contractor is likely to have a wealth of experience, which can be invaluable for your project. Don't forget to ask for references. An experienced contractor should have a list of previous clients who can vouch for their quality of work.
Another important area to investigate is the contractor's pricing structure. Request a detailed estimate to understand what is included in the cost. It's essential to be wary of unusually low bids as they might indicate subpar materials or hidden costs that will surface later. Transparency in pricing is crucial to avoid any unexpected expenses during the project.
Communication is key throughout the hiring process. Observe how the contractor interacts with you and whether they are willing to provide clear, comprehensive answers to your questions. A contractor who communicates poorly during the initial stages is unlikely to be communicative once the project begins. Ensure you understand the timeline for the project and what measures will be in place to handle potential disruptions.
While evaluating potential contractors, watch for red flags that may indicate problems down the line. A lack of written contracts or unwillingness to provide a detailed agreement is a major warning sign. A reputable contractor will provide a thorough written agreement outlining the scope of work, materials, timelines, and payment terms.
Additionally, if the contractor is pressuring you to make a hasty decision, it might be best to walk away. Decision pressure can indicate desperation or an attempt to close a deal before all necessary details have been discussed.
